.SummaryCard_card__GkOtx{background:#fff;border-radius:16px;padding:1.5rem;box-shadow:0 4px 20px rgba(0,0,0,.08);transition:transform .2s ease,box-shadow .2s ease}.SummaryCard_card__GkOtx:hover{transform:translateY(-4px);box-shadow:0 8px 30px rgba(0,0,0,.12)}.SummaryCard_header__t6bPk{display:flex;align-items:center;gap:.75rem;margin-bottom:1rem}.SummaryCard_icon__qucIQ{font-size:1.75rem;width:48px;height:48px;display:flex;align-items:center;justify-content:center;border-radius:12px;background:rgba(220,38,38,.1)}.SummaryCard_title__sOFE8{font-size:.95rem;font-weight:600;color:#64748b;margin:0}.SummaryCard_amounts___xHSv{display:flex;flex-direction:column;gap:.25rem}.SummaryCard_amountUsd__o2y61{font-size:1.75rem;font-weight:700;color:#1e293b;margin:0}.SummaryCard_amountLbp__8w_pZ{font-size:.9rem;color:#94a3b8;margin:0}.SummaryCard_sales__RwX54 .SummaryCard_icon__qucIQ{background:rgba(34,197,94,.1)}.SummaryCard_sales__RwX54 .SummaryCard_amountUsd__o2y61{color:#16a34a}.SummaryCard_expenses__S98Jz .SummaryCard_icon__qucIQ{background:rgba(220,38,38,.1)}.SummaryCard_expenses__S98Jz .SummaryCard_amountUsd__o2y61{color:#dc2626}.SummaryCard_profit__2jmit .SummaryCard_icon__qucIQ{background:rgba(245,158,11,.1)}.SummaryCard_profit__2jmit .SummaryCard_amountUsd__o2y61{color:#d97706}.SummaryCard_loss__bguFO .SummaryCard_icon__qucIQ{background:rgba(239,68,68,.1)}.SummaryCard_loss__bguFO .SummaryCard_amountUsd__o2y61{color:#ef4444}@media (max-width:768px){.SummaryCard_card__GkOtx{padding:1.25rem}.SummaryCard_amountUsd__o2y61{font-size:1.5rem}}.Modal_overlay__cza8g{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.5);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);display:flex;align-items:center;justify-content:center;z-index:1000;padding:1rem}.Modal_modal__BlcpV{background:#fff;border-radius:20px;width:100%;max-width:500px;max-height:90vh;overflow:auto;box-shadow:0 25px 50px -12px rgba(0,0,0,.25);animation:Modal_slideUp__tXIN7 .3s ease}@keyframes Modal_slideUp__tXIN7{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.Modal_header__nqLWP{display:flex;align-items:center;justify-content:space-between;padding:1.5rem;border-bottom:1px solid #e5e7eb}.Modal_title__JXUjh{font-size:1.25rem;font-weight:700;color:#1e293b;margin:0}.Modal_closeBtn__auQSX{width:36px;height:36px;border:none;border-radius:50%;background:#f3f4f6;color:#6b7280;cursor:pointer;font-size:1rem;transition:all .2s ease;display:flex;align-items:center;justify-content:center}.Modal_closeBtn__auQSX:hover{background:#fee2e2;color:#dc2626}.Modal_content__I_pH0{padding:1.5rem}@media (max-width:768px){.Modal_overlay__cza8g{padding:.5rem;align-items:flex-end}.Modal_modal__BlcpV{max-height:85vh;border-radius:20px 20px 0 0;margin-bottom:0}.Modal_header__nqLWP{padding:1rem;position:-webkit-sticky;position:sticky;top:0;background:#fff;z-index:1}.Modal_title__JXUjh{font-size:1.1rem}.Modal_content__I_pH0{padding:1rem}}@media (max-width:480px){.Modal_overlay__cza8g{padding:0}.Modal_modal__BlcpV{max-height:90vh;border-radius:16px 16px 0 0}.Modal_header__nqLWP{padding:.875rem}.Modal_title__JXUjh{font-size:1rem}.Modal_content__I_pH0{padding:.875rem}.Modal_closeBtn__auQSX{width:32px;height:32px}}.CurrencyInput_wrapper__Acr8q{display:flex;flex-direction:column;gap:.5rem}.CurrencyInput_label__xuAGk{font-size:.875rem;font-weight:600;color:#374151}.CurrencyInput_required__ntMoB{color:#dc2626}.CurrencyInput_inputGroup__Ubqip{display:flex;gap:0;border:2px solid #e5e7eb;border-radius:12px;overflow:hidden;transition:border-color .2s ease}.CurrencyInput_inputGroup__Ubqip:focus-within{border-color:#dc2626}.CurrencyInput_input__lzr6s{flex:1 1;padding:.875rem 1rem;font-size:1rem;border:none;outline:none;background:#fff}.CurrencyInput_input__lzr6s::placeholder{color:#9ca3af}.CurrencyInput_currencyToggle__0scli{display:flex;background:#f3f4f6}.CurrencyInput_currencyBtn__RqUWf{padding:.5rem .75rem;font-size:.875rem;font-weight:600;border:none;background:transparent;color:#6b7280;cursor:pointer;transition:all .2s ease}.CurrencyInput_currencyBtn__RqUWf:hover{background:#e5e7eb}.CurrencyInput_currencyBtn__RqUWf.CurrencyInput_active__66jgX{background:#dc2626;color:#fff}.CurrencyInput_conversion__I963k{font-size:.8rem;color:#6b7280;margin:0;padding-left:.25rem}@media (max-width:480px){.CurrencyInput_currencyBtn__RqUWf{padding:.75rem .5rem;font-size:.75rem}}.SearchableSelect_wrapper__Tcyr8{position:relative;margin-bottom:1rem}.SearchableSelect_label__Ibfeq{display:block;margin-bottom:.5rem;font-size:.9rem;font-weight:500;color:var(--text-secondary)}.SearchableSelect_required__eRqC1{color:var(--danger);margin-left:.25rem}.SearchableSelect_control__eE9AI{background:var(--bg-card);border:1px solid var(--border-color);border-radius:8px;padding:.75rem 1rem;display:flex;justify-content:space-between;align-items:center;cursor:pointer;transition:all .2s;-webkit-user-select:none;-moz-user-select:none;user-select:none}.SearchableSelect_control__eE9AI:hover{border-color:var(--primary)}.SearchableSelect_placeholder__ze027{color:var(--text-tertiary)}.SearchableSelect_selectedValue__L4FaP{color:var(--text-primary);font-size:1rem}.SearchableSelect_dropdown__ulSuc{position:absolute;top:100%;left:0;right:0;background:var(--bg-card);border:1px solid var(--border-color);border-radius:8px;margin-top:.5rem;box-shadow:0 4px 12px rgba(0,0,0,.1);z-index:50;overflow:hidden}.SearchableSelect_searchInput__oSFaM{width:100%;padding:.75rem;border:none;border-bottom:1px solid var(--border-color);background:var(--bg-background);color:var(--text-primary);outline:none}.SearchableSelect_optionsList__VZWGD{max-height:200px;overflow-y:auto}.SearchableSelect_option__nxuHA{padding:.75rem 1rem;cursor:pointer;transition:background .2s;color:var(--text-primary)}.SearchableSelect_option__nxuHA:hover{background:var(--bg-background)}.SearchableSelect_selected__Ffl3B{background:var(--primary-light);color:var(--primary);font-weight:500}.SearchableSelect_noOptions__HnEyl{padding:1rem;color:var(--text-tertiary);text-align:center;font-size:.9rem}.ReceiptModal_modalOverlay__yjpgA{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.5);display:flex;justify-content:center;align-items:center;z-index:1000}.ReceiptModal_modalContent__5_uw6{background:#fff;padding:20px;border-radius:8px;width:90%;max-width:500px;position:relative;box-shadow:0 4px 6px rgba(0,0,0,.1)}.ReceiptModal_closeButton__JP_F5{position:absolute;top:10px;right:10px;background:none;border:none;font-size:1.5rem;cursor:pointer;color:#666}.ReceiptModal_receiptContainer__SIO1m{display:none}